All Rights Reserved. // See LICENSE.txt for license information. import {defineMessage, type IntlShape} from 'react-intl'; import {isErrorWithMessage} from '@utils/errors'; // MSAL Error Domain and Codes const MSAL_ERROR_DOMAIN = 'MSALErrorDomain'; const MSAL_ERROR_CODE_USER_CANCELED = -50005; // Intune Error Domain and Codes const INTUNE_ERROR_DOMAIN = 'Intune'; const INTUNE_ERROR_CODE_PROTECTION_POLICY_REQUIRED = 1004; // i18n message definitions const intuneErrorMessages = { loginCanceled: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.login.canceled', defaultMessage: 'Login was canceled. Please try again', }), authFailed: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.login.failed', defaultMessage: 'Authentication failed. Please try again', }), complianceNotCompliant: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.compliance.not_compliant', defaultMessage: "Your device doesn't meet the required app protection policy.", }), complianceNetworkFailure: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.compliance.network_failure', defaultMessage: 'Could not reach the Intune service. Check your network and try again.', }), complianceServiceFailure: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.compliance.service_failure', defaultMessage: 'Intune service error. Please try again later.', }), complianceUserCancelled: defineMessage({ id: 'mobile.intune.compliance.user_cancelled', defaultMessage: 'Login was canceled. Please try again.', }), }; // RN serializes NSError.domain onto the JS error object, but NSError.code may be // replaced by the string reject-code passed to reject(). We accept both for robustness // and also extract the numeric code from the message string when needed. type NSError = {domain: string; code: number | string; message?: string; userInfo?: Record}; function isNSError(error: unknown): error is NSError { return ( typeof error === 'object' && error !== null && 'domain' in error && 'code' in error && typeof (error as {domain: unknown}).domain === 'string' ); } // Extracts the numeric NSError code from the sanitized message: "Error in (code: )" function extractNativeCode(error: NSError): number | null { if (typeof error.code === 'number') { return error.code; } if (/^-?\d+$/.test(error.code)) { return parseInt(error.code, 10); } const match = error.message?.match(/\(code: (-?\d+)\)/); return match ? parseInt(match[1], 10) : null; } /** * Check if error is MSAL user cancellation */ export function isMSALUserCancellation(error: unknown): boolean { if (!isNSError(error) || error.domain !== MSAL_ERROR_DOMAIN) { return false; } return extractNativeCode(error) === MSAL_ERROR_CODE_USER_CANCELED; } /** * Map Intune/MSAL error to user-friendly i18n message * Handles: * - Server errors (400, 409, 428) * - MSAL cancellation errors (-50005) * - Generic MSAL errors * * @param error - The error object from nativeEntraLogin * @param intl - IntlShape for formatting messages * @returns User-friendly error message */ export function getIntuneErrorMessage(error: unknown, intl: IntlShape): string { // Handle MSAL user cancellation (domain: MSALErrorDomain, code: -50005) if (isMSALUserCancellation(error)) { return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.loginCanceled); } // Handle compliance failure (domain: Intune, code: 1004) // SDK provides localized errorMessage in userInfo — use it directly when available if (isNSError(error) && error.domain === INTUNE_ERROR_DOMAIN && extractNativeCode(error) === INTUNE_ERROR_CODE_PROTECTION_POLICY_REQUIRED) { const sdkMessage = error.userInfo?.errorMessage; if (sdkMessage) { return sdkMessage; } switch (error.userInfo?.reason) { case 'not_compliant': return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.complianceNotCompliant); case 'network_failure': return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.complianceNetworkFailure); case 'service_failure': return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.complianceServiceFailure); default: return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.complianceUserCancelled); } } // Handle generic MSAL errors (other MSALErrorDomain codes) if (isNSError(error) && error.domain === MSAL_ERROR_DOMAIN) { return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.authFailed); } // Handle any other error with message if (isErrorWithMessage(error)) { // Check for raw MSAL error strings in message if (error.message.includes(MSAL_ERROR_DOMAIN) || error.message.includes('code:')) { return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.authFailed); } return error.message; } // Fallback for unknown errors return intl.formatMessage(intuneErrorMessages.authFailed); }
